| #ifdef HAVE_XWIN_CONFIG_H
 | |
| #include <xwin-config.h>
 | |
| #endif
 | |
| #include "win.h"
 | |
| 
 | |
| /* See Porting Layer Definition - p. 58 */
 | |
| /*
 | |
|  * Allocate indexes for the privates that we use.
 | |
|  * Allocate memory directly for the screen privates.
 | |
|  * Reserve space in GCs and Pixmaps for our privates.
 | |
|  * Colormap privates are handled in winAllocateCmapPrivates ()
 | |
|  */
 | |
| 
 | |
| Bool
 | |
| winAllocatePrivates(ScreenPtr pScreen)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     winPrivScreenPtr pScreenPriv;
 | |
| 
 | |
| #if CYGDEBUG
 | |
|     winDebug("winAllocateScreenPrivates - g_ulServerGeneration: %lu "
 | |
|              "serverGeneration: %lu\n", g_ulServerGeneration, serverGeneration);
 | |
| #endif
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* We need a new slot for our privates if the screen gen has changed */
 | |
|     if (g_ulServerGeneration != serverGeneration) {
 | |
|         g_ulServerGeneration = serverGeneration;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Allocate memory for the screen private structure */
 | |
|     pScreenPriv = malloc(sizeof(winPrivScreenRec));
 | |
|     if (!pScreenPriv) {
 | |
|         ErrorF("winAllocateScreenPrivates - malloc () failed\n");
 | |
|         return FALSE;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Initialize the memory of the private structure */
 | |
|     ZeroMemory(pScreenPriv, sizeof(winPrivScreenRec));
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Intialize private structure members */
 | |
|     pScreenPriv->fActive = TRUE;
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Register our screen private */
 | |
|     if (!dixRegisterPrivateKey(g_iScreenPrivateKey, PRIVATE_SCREEN, 0)) {
 | |
|         ErrorF("winAllocatePrivates - AllocateScreenPrivate () failed\n");
 | |
|         return FALSE;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Save the screen private pointer */
 | |
|     winSetScreenPriv(pScreen, pScreenPriv);
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Reserve Pixmap memory for our privates */
 | |
|     if (!dixRegisterPrivateKey
 | |
|         (g_iPixmapPrivateKey, PRIVATE_PIXMAP, sizeof(winPrivPixmapRec))) {
 | |
|         ErrorF("winAllocatePrivates - AllocatePixmapPrivates () failed\n");
 | |
|         return FALSE;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Reserve Window memory for our privates */
 | |
|     if (!dixRegisterPrivateKey
 | |
|         (g_iWindowPrivateKey, PRIVATE_WINDOW, sizeof(winPrivWinRec))) {
 | |
|         ErrorF("winAllocatePrivates () - AllocateWindowPrivates () failed\n");
 | |
|         return FALSE;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     return TRUE;
 | |
| }

| /*
 | |
|  * Colormap privates may be allocated after the default colormap has
 | |
|  * already been created for some screens.  This initialization procedure
 | |
|  * is called for each default colormap that is found.
 | |
|  */
 | |
| 
 | |
| Bool
 | |
| winInitCmapPrivates(ColormapPtr pcmap, int i)
 | |
| {
 | |
| #if CYGDEBUG
 | |
|     winDebug("winInitCmapPrivates\n");
 | |
| #endif
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/*
 | |
|      * I see no way that this function can do anything useful
 | |
|      * with only a ColormapPtr.  We don't have the index for
 | |
|      * our dev privates yet, so we can't really initialize
 | |
|      * anything.  Perhaps I am misunderstanding the purpose
 | |
|      * of this function.
 | |
|      */
 | |
|     /*  That's definitely true.
 | |
|      *  I therefore changed the API and added the index as argument.
 | |
|      */
 | |
|     return TRUE;
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| /*
 | |
|  * Allocate memory for our colormap privates
 | |
|  */
 | |
| 
 | |
| Bool
 | |
| winAllocateCmapPrivates(ColormapPtr pCmap)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     winPrivCmapPtr pCmapPriv;
 | |
|     static unsigned long s_ulPrivateGeneration = 0;
 | |
| 
 | |
| #if CYGDEBUG
 | |
|     winDebug("winAllocateCmapPrivates\n");
 | |
| #endif
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Get a new privates index when the server generation changes */
 | |
|     if (s_ulPrivateGeneration != serverGeneration) {
 | |
|         /* Save the new server generation */
 | |
|         s_ulPrivateGeneration = serverGeneration;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Allocate memory for our private structure */
 | |
|     pCmapPriv = malloc(sizeof(winPrivCmapRec));
 | |
|     if (!pCmapPriv) {
 | |
|         ErrorF("winAllocateCmapPrivates - malloc () failed\n");
 | |
|         return FALSE;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Initialize the memory of the private structure */
 | |
|     ZeroMemory(pCmapPriv, sizeof(winPrivCmapRec));
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Register our colourmap private */
 | |
|     if (!dixRegisterPrivateKey(g_iCmapPrivateKey, PRIVATE_COLORMAP, 0)) {
 | |
|         ErrorF("winAllocateCmapPrivates - AllocateCmapPrivate () failed\n");
 | |
|         return FALSE;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Save the cmap private pointer */
 | |
|     winSetCmapPriv(pCmap, pCmapPriv);
 | |
| 
 | |
| #if CYGDEBUG
 | |
|     winDebug("winAllocateCmapPrivates - Returning\n");
 | |
| #endif
 | |
| 
 | |
|     return TRUE;
 | |
| }
